Upon receiving a subpoena, the first step is to carefully review its contents to understand the demands and the deadline for compliance. It's crucial to determine whether the subpoena is valid and to consult legal counsel if there are any concerns about compliance or potential objections. A response may involve producing the requested documents or information, or, if necessary, filing a motion to quash or modify the subpoena. It's important to respond within the specified timeframe to avoid legal penalties.

You should not always reply to a memo; it depends on the context and the content. If the memo requires action, feedback, or confirmation, a response is necessary to ensure clarity and accountability. However, if the memo is informational and does not call for a reply, acknowledging receipt may suffice, or no response may be needed at all. Always consider the expectations set by the sender.
